2AM3

Crystal Structure of N-Acetylglucosaminyltransferase I in Complex with UDP-Glucose

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sAPS BEAMLINE 19-BM
Synchrotron siteAPS
Beamline19-BM
Temperature [K]100
Detector technologyCCD
Collection date2003-07-13
DetectorSBC-3
Wavelength(s)1.0332
Spacegroup nameP 21 21 21
Unit cell lengths40.628, 82.492, 102.250
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ution32.100 - 1.800
Rwork0.186
R-free0.22600
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)1fo9 1foa
RMSD bond length0.008
RMSD bond angle1.500
Data reduction softwareHKL-2000
Data scaling softwareSCALEPACK
Phasing softwareCNS
Refinement softwareCNS (1.1)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]32.1001.910
High resolution limit [Å]1.8001.800
Number of reflections26941
Completeness [%]82.578.6
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P7.929340% PEG 6000, 1M Tris, MnCl2, pH 7.9, VAPOR DIFFUSION, HANGING DROP, temperature 293K
